Summit Raceway in Fort Wayne, IN is now open. This new carpet track has an 80' x 36' layout for road course racing, that also transforms into an oval track.
The next road course race will be a New Year's day road race with gift certificate payouts for the top finishers. Doors open at 10:00 AM, with racing at 1:00.
Summit Raceway is located in the Gateway Plaza Shopping Center, on Goshen Rd. Take I-69 to exit 109, straight thru 3 lights, turn right at the 4th.
For more info, check the web at Summit Raceway or at the SARC club website at SARC Club Website
Club road racing every Tuesday night, and road course racing every other Sunday afternoon. Check the race calendars on either website for dates and times. Hope to see you there!

There is an option in the Autoscore program on the computer that allows you to run a race without entering any names. If all the equipment is on, you could start that up and run your practice with a transponder. You should then be able to view or print out the lap times.
